#1dbbb6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1dbbb6 is composed of 11.4% red, 73.3% green and 71.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 2.7%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 178.1 degrees, a saturation of 73.1% and a lightness of 42.4%. #1dbbb6 color hex could be obtained by blending #3affff with #00776d.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#1dbbb6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1dbbb6 has RGB values of R:29, G:187, B:182 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0, Y:0.03,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 1948598.

Shades and Tints of #1dbbb6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#eefc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#1dbbb6
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#687070 is the less saturated color, while #04d4cd is the most saturated one.
